Reverse Osmosis Installation in Columbus, OH
Reverse osmosis installation services provide homeowners with a reliable way to improve the quality of their drinking water. This process involves setting up a filtration system that uses a semi-permeable membrane to remove contaminants, sediments, and impurities from the tap water. Projects typically include installing new reverse osmosis units under sinks, in laundry rooms, or in dedicated water treatment areas, ensuring access to cleaner, better-tasting water throughout the home.
Property owners interested in reverse osmosis installation often want to understand the system’s capacity, maintenance requirements, and compatibility with existing plumbing. It’s also common to inquire about the types of contaminants that can be effectively removed and whether the system will meet specific water quality needs. Clarifying these details helps ensure the chosen system aligns with the household's water usage and quality expectations.

Reverse Osmosis Installation Questions
What is reverse osmosis water treatment? Reverse osmosis is a filtration process that removes impurities and contaminants from tap water by forcing it through a semi-permeable membrane.
What types of properties typically need reverse osmosis installation? Homes with concerns about water quality, such as high mineral content or contaminants, often opt for reverse osmosis systems.
How does the installation process usually work? The system is installed by connecting it to existing water lines, typically under the kitchen sink or at a designated point of use.
What maintenance is required for reverse osmosis systems? Regular filter replacements and periodic system checks help ensure optimal performance and water quality.
